HOLLYWOOD – Hard Rock Live in Hollywood is among the 13 venues that Paul McCartney will play during his “Got Back” tour. The 7,000-seat arena at Seminole Hard Rock Hotel & Casino Hollywood announced Friday that McCartney will perform May 25 at 8 p.m. The performance will be three weeks prior to his 80th birthday.

McCartney fan club members and American Express card members can access presale tickets beginning Feb. 22 at 10 a.m. Fans can also access venue presale tickets Feb. 24 from 10 a.m. to 10 p.m. through Seminole Hard Rock Hollywood’s Facebook and Twitter pages. Tickets are scheduled to be on sale at 10 a.m. Feb. 25 at www.myhrl.com.

Some of the other venues on the tour include Camping World Stadium in Orlando (May 28), Boston’s famed Fenway Park (June 7), MetLife Stadium (June 16) in New Jersey and So-Fi Stadium (May 13) in Los Angeles, site of this year’s Super Bowl.

McCartney’s concert in Hollywood is scheduled three days after a performance by Sting at Hard Rock Live. Billy Idol kicks off the month with a concert May 1.
